Can you put celery in a Magic Bullet?
Whether you’ve got a Magic Bullet, Nutribullet, Ninja, or some reliable blender bought decades ago, you can make celery juice in a blender. To remove the fiber, you’ll also need a fine-mesh nut milk bag. Celery’s pungent flavors were once covered in globs of peanut butter and raisin ants.
Which is better NutriBullet or Magic Bullet?
The biggest difference between the NutriBullet and the Magic Bullet is the motor size. The Magic Bullet has a 250 watt motor, which is fine for basic fruit smoothies as well as most soups and sauces, but not as effective for green smoothies or frozen and raw ingredients.
Can you put ice in a Magic Bullet?
The simple answer is, yes, you can put ice in the Magic bullet. The blades of the blender are enough strong to handle the ice. The blades of the Magic Bullet are quite sharp that it can shred the ice easily. Many users have been using the magic bullet efficiently to make smoothies that have key ingredient is ice.

What is better than a NutriBullet?
The Ninja Professional Plus Blender with Auto-iQ is a better, more versatile blender than the NutriBullet Blender Combo. The Ninja is better-built and easier to clean, and it can crush ice, unlike the NutriBullet. However, the NutriBullet comes with two additional personal-sized jars.

Can you put frozen fruit in a NutriBullet?
Although most NutriBullet can handle frozen fruit, remember frozen fruit is harder than fresh fruit. It is best to let the fruit thaw a little first, especially with the smaller models. Just take the fruit out of the freezer, prep the rest of the ingredients.

Which is better ninja or magic bullet?
The Ninja Nutri Ninja Pro is a better personal blender than the Magic Bullet Mini. The Ninja is better-built, and it makes a more spreadable almond butter. Unlike the Magic Bullet, it can crush ice, and it’s easier to clean. However, the Magic Bullet makes a better smoothie.
Why is a NutriBullet better than a blender?
The Nutribullet is designed to quickly blend fruit and vegetables at a high speed and is easy to use and clean. It is an effective solution for making quick, well-blended smoothies. Whereas, a blender with equivalent strength motor is obviously larger and is intended for a wider range of uses.

Can you blend dry ingredients in a NutriBullet?
NutriBullet Pro 900, like all single-serving blenders, has limited functionality and is only useful for smoothies and works well with fresh fruits and vegetables. Never use this blender without any liquid, and you can only use dry ingredients without liquid for grinding/milling purposes.
Does NutriBullet 900 crush ice?
Performance. When testing for long-term durability, Consumer Reports found that the blades of the NutriBullet Pro 900 Series tended to break under extended high-pressure use. They ran 45 tests in which they blend seven large cubes of ice to simulate long-term wear and tear.

Why blender is so expensive?
Most blenders are defined by their blades and their motors. And when you compare a Vitamix blender against a standard blender, you will see that they have a much higher horsepower. This is why they are so expensive.
Do you really need a blender?
Simply speaking, a blender is a better option for items with a lot of liquid, like smoothies and soups. A food processor is best suited for foods that are mainly solid and require more labor intensive handling, such as chopping and slicing.
